The transfection used to create 293T (involving plasmid pRSV-1609) conferred neomycin/G418 resistance and expression of the tsA1609 allele of SV40 large T antigen; this allele is fully active at 33 °C (its permissive temperature), has substantial function at 37 °C, and is inactive at 40 °C. 293T is very efficiently transfectable with DNA (like its parent …

Finally, the hair’s central core is called the medulla, which, when present in the hair (sometimes it’s not), may or may not be filled with air, in which case it appears as an opaque or black structure when viewed under a microscope. In some cases, it may also present a fragmented or continuous structure.
